Job Description
The candidate will be responsible for observing, monitoring, and reporting results of engine or vehicle tests using computer-controlled systems to measure engine lubricant, fuel, or engine performance. The role requires following written and verbal instructions, calibrating test equipment for measuring engine performance at specific time intervals, maintaining log files of various test types according to test procedures, preparing, extracting, and labeling specimens as described in the test procedures/instructions, and performing routine maintenance of engines.

The work environment is a lab setting where the candidate will be monitoring engines and fluids. Ear protection and a lab coat will be provided. The candidate must be flexible to work on any of the following shifts: 12am-8:30am, 8am-4:30pm, or 4pm-12:30am
